Concentrix Philippines, the country’s largest private employer with over 100,000 workers, has launched KALIX, an integrated health hub that provides free medical services for employees and their eligible dependents.
The facility, which opened on Wednesday at Exxa Bridgetowne, can serve about 28,000 employees — whom the company calls “game-changers” — as well as their families, including those working from home in Metro Manila.
KALIX is designed to deliver primary care, multi-specialty consultations, diagnostics, physical therapy, heart screenings, and preventive care services such as annual physical exams and executive check-ups. All services are offered at no cost to employees and do not affect their existing HMO benefits.
The name “KALIX” comes from the Filipino words kalusugan (health) and kalinga (care), combined with “ix” for intelligent experience.

The health hub is supported by a dedicated medical team — including doctors, nurses, medtechs, a drug test analyst, and a radiation technician — and a digital portal for appointment booking, results access, and medical records.
